Get started73 Kynaston Road is a three-bedroom mid-terrace house in Hackney, London, London (N16 0EB). It has a recorded floor area of 140 m² (around 1507 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1900-1929 and council tax band E. The latest certificate (March 2020) shows a C (score 71). When first surveyed in November 2009 the rating was D,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, roof efficiency went from Average to Very Good, window efficiency went from Poor to Average and lighting went from Good to Very Good. The recommended improvements would push it to B (score 84). Period features are noted in the property record. Records show the property has been extended at some point in its history.
Held since April 2010 — that's 16 years off the open market, well above the local norm. Sale prices here have outpaced London HPI: 7.4%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£1,694,000 sits 164.7% above the 2010 sale of £640,000. At 140 m² the property is well over the postcode median (92 m² across 14 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. Its energy rating outperforms most of the postcode (better than 86% of similar EPCs). 2 planning records sit against the property, 2 approved, 0 refused. Past consents include an extension,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ved.
